Since recreational cannabis was legalized in October 2018, Canadian federal and provincial governments have collected over $5.4 billion in tax revenue, with the federal government receiving $1.2 billion and provinces $4.2 billion.

Alberta led in per capita revenue at $210, while Quebec had the lowest at $55.31.

Health Canada spent about $21.6 million on prevention and education since legalization, increasing to $2.3 million in 2024–25, with an additional $29.6 million allocated to 26 initiatives.

Data for 2025 covers only the first five months, and Manitoba is excluded as it operates outside the federal taxation framework.
